#f215da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f215da is composed of 94.9% red, 8.2%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.3%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 306.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 51.6%. #f215da color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2aff with #e500b5.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

#f215da color description : Vivid magenta.

#f215da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f215da has RGB values of R:242, G:21,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.1,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15865306.

Shades and Tints of #f215da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080007 is the darkest color, while #fef4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f215da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a7e88 is the less saturated color, while #fc0ce1 is the most saturated one.
